[CRASH?] hovering "Erase all" cookies' button crashes Vivaldi
Try this:
- start Vivaldi in private mode (i.e. vivaldi --incognito)
- open preferences
- search for cookies section (type cook, into the search field)
- hover, on the "Delete all cookies" button two, or three times OR click and double click here, and there into the cookies settings (even in empty areas: where there are no radio buttons, or buttons, or settings to choose - just click here and there)
This should crash Vivaldi. Crashes only, in private mode, here.
Anyone confirms?
